Chonburi AI-Driven Fermentation Process Control

Chonburi AI-Driven Fermentation Process Control is an innovative technology that utilizes artificial intelligence (AI) and machine learning algorithms to optimize and control fermentation processes in various industries, including food and beverage, pharmaceuticals, and biofuels. This advanced system offers several key benefits and applications for businesses:

  1. Enhanced Process Control: Chonburi AI-Driven Fermentation Process Control provides real-time monitoring and control of fermentation parameters, such as temperature, pH, and dissolved oxygen, ensuring optimal conditions for microbial growth and product yield.
  2. Predictive Analytics: By analyzing historical data and real-time sensor readings, the system can predict fermentation outcomes and identify potential deviations, enabling proactive adjustments to maintain process stability and product quality.
  3. Reduced Downtime: The AI-driven system continuously monitors and analyzes fermentation processes, detecting anomalies and potential issues early on. This allows businesses to take timely corrective actions, minimizing downtime and maximizing production efficiency.
  4. Improved Product Quality: Chonburi AI-Driven Fermentation Process Control ensures consistent and high-quality products by optimizing fermentation conditions and preventing contamination or spoilage. This leads to increased customer satisfaction and brand reputation.
  5. Increased Productivity: By optimizing fermentation processes and reducing downtime, businesses can increase production capacity and throughput, leading to higher profits and improved return on investment.
  6. Sustainability: The AI-driven system promotes sustainable fermentation practices by optimizing resource utilization, reducing waste, and minimizing environmental impact.
